Understanding Air Brakes

Before diving into the specifics of air brake courses, it’s essential to understand what air brakes are and why they are so important. Air brakes are a type of braking system used in heavy vehicles like trucks, buses, and trailers. Unlike hydraulic brakes used in regular cars, air brakes utilize compressed air to apply pressure on the brake pads, which in turn stops the vehicle. This system is particularly effective for large, heavy vehicles due to its ability to generate significant force, its reliability, and its capacity to maintain braking efficiency even under the high demands of commercial use.

Why Air Brake Certification is Necessary

In Canada, air brake systems are a legal requirement for many commercial vehicles. To operate a vehicle equipped with an air brake system, drivers must obtain an air brake endorsement, often referred to as a "Q" endorsement, on their driver’s license. This endorsement ensures that drivers have the necessary knowledge and skills to safely operate vehicles with air brakes.

The process of obtaining this endorsement is not just a formality; it’s a critical step in ensuring road safety. Air brakes, while effective, require specific knowledge to operate correctly. Misuse or lack of understanding can lead to brake failure, which in turn can cause serious accidents. As such, the government mandates that all drivers who operate vehicles with air brakes undergo proper training and pass both a written and practical test.

The Structure of Air Brake Courses

Air brake courses in Edmonton are designed to provide comprehensive training on the theory and operation of air brake systems. These courses typically cover a range of topics, including:

  • Introduction to Air Brake Systems: This section covers the basics of how air brakes work, including the principles of air pressure, the components of the system, and the differences between air brakes and hydraulic brakes.
  • System Components: Students learn about the various parts of the air brake system, such as the compressor, reservoirs, foot valve, brake chambers, and the slack adjusters. Understanding these components is crucial for diagnosing and troubleshooting issues.
  • System Operation: This involves learning how the entire air brake system works together to stop a vehicle. This includes understanding how air is compressed, stored, and used to apply the brakes.
  • Inspection and Maintenance: Regular inspection and maintenance are essential for ensuring the safety and functionality of air brakes. Courses teach students how to properly inspect air brake systems, identify potential issues, and perform basic maintenance tasks.
  • Practical Application: In addition to theoretical knowledge, students get hands-on experience in operating air brake systems. This includes performing pre-trip inspections, practicing emergency stops, and understanding how to adjust brakes.
  • Safety Procedures: Safety is a key focus throughout the course. Students learn about the potential dangers of air brake systems, such as brake fade, and how to mitigate these risks through proper operation and maintenance.
